The company was founded in 1884 when Jewish refugee Michael Marks opened a stall in an open market in Leeds. The stall's sign said "Don't ask the price - it's only a penny". Marks invited Thomas Spencer to become a partner once the business was successful. Spencer contributed 300 pounds, and his experience in management and accounting complemented Marks' flair for selling and selling merchandise.

M&S stores were created in the beginning to adjust to changing social conditions. Marks changed to meet changing social conditions by using open displays, which encouraged browsing and self selection. At this point the company's growth was rapid. In 1915, it had 145 stores.

In the 1960s, M&S started to develop its own brand of products. This included the introduction of synthetic fibres such as Tricell and Coutelle, and woollens that could be machine washed. Lingerie gained a fashionable 'edge' in the 1980s, with coordinated sets that were based on fashion trends from the catwalk.

M&S is committed to reducing its impact on the environment. It has formulated a 100-point eco-plan, which affects every aspect of the business, from heating in the store to the labelling of products. The goal is to cut down on emissions, promoting healthy food, creating fair partnerships, and using sustainable raw materials.

Hennes & Mauritz AB, founded in 1947, is the second-largest fashion retailer in the world. Its success is based on fast fashion. This means identifying trends and getting low-cost copies of the latest trends to stores as quickly as possible. H&M is different from other retailers who take months to create and create new styles, H&M is able to create an entire collection in just two weeks. The stores of H&M are always stocked with new clothing.
